A triangle has an area of 38.4cm squared the height of the triangle is 12.8cm. what is the length of the base of the triangle?

Respuesta :

jensen2020j jensen2020j
  • 20-01-2021

Answer: 6 cm

Step-by-step explanation:  [tex]\frac{1}{2}b(12.8cm)= 38.4 cm^2 \\b= 6[/tex]
